The health department has logged six inspections at The Brown Bagger Company, the earliest from 2022. The newest entry in the record is dated Nov 12, 2025. A low risk tier reflects an inspection that turned up minimal issues.

Things have been moving in the right direction, with the rolling count dropping from around four violations to closer to one violation per visit.

“Floor not cleaned when the least amount of food is exposed” comes up most often, recorded two times in the inspection record.

Compared to other Pensacola restaurants (averaging 95), there's room to close the gap. The full picture is one of consistent compliance.
